Call Handling Options
When a call is active, and depending on the type of call in
progress, there are a number of Phone menu options that
become available. For example, with a conference call, more
menu options become available with regards to conference call
handling requirements. The following is a list of options that can
be accessed through the Phone menu. For more information on
how to use the options see “When a Call is in Progress” on page
45..
Menu Option Function
Release all Terminates all calls.
Extract Select a party in the conference to have a
private conversation with.
Release Select a party to be released from the
conference.
Parties in conf Displays the conference parties, by name or
number if there is a matching entry in the
contacts database and call line ID number.
Switch calls Places an active call on hold and retrieves a
held call.
Transfer calls Connects two remote parties together,
active and held calls, while disconnecting
yourself. This is not available if a conference
call is active.
Join calls Joins an existing call to a conference, up to a
maximum of 5 parties.
Release active Terminates the active call.
Release held Releases a held call.
Hold call Places the current active call on hold.
DTMF tones Allows DTMF tones to be muted while
making a notepad entry during a call to
prevent them from being audible to the
other party.
